About Company

As a global Test & Quality Solution leader, Averna partners with product designers, developers and OEMs to help them achieve higher product quality, accelerate time to market and protect their brands. Founded in 1999, Averna offers specialized expertise and innovative test, vision inspection, precision assembly and automated solutions that deliver substantial technical, financial and market benefits for clients in the automotive and EV, life-science, battery, consumer electronics, industrial, telecom, transportation, and aerospace and defense industries. Averna has offices around the world, numerous industry certifications such as ISO and is ITAR registered.
